Bennedict Mathurin (IND) over 14.5 points ( -125)'

This line is below Mathurin's rookie average of 16.7 ppg and he slides into a starting role in year 2. The Pacers’ new-look starting 5 is Tyrese Haliburton, Bennedict Mathurin, Bruce Brown, Obi Toppin and Myles Turner. Hield and Andrew Nembhard will trot out the second unit but I like Mathurin to be a real scoring threat with the starters. The Wizards are specifically front-court heavy, but Jordan Poole and Tyus Jones should be a great matchup for Mathurin out of the gate. Mathurin will likely have to play just under 26 minutes to hit this line, which he did in 56 of 77 contests (75%) and 12 of 17 as a starter (70%). 0.75U
